How To Fix OM525 - Manual maintenance of revaluated movement type group & not allowed


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: OM - Customizing Materialwirtschaft

  • Message number: 525

  • Message text: Manual maintenance of revaluated movement type group & not allowed

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message OM525 - Manual maintenance of revaluated movement type group & not allowed ?

    The SAP error message OM525 typically occurs when there is an attempt to manually maintain a revaluated movement type group in the system, which is not allowed. This error is related to the configuration of movement types in the SAP system, particularly in the context of inventory management and material valuation.

    Cause:

    The error arises because the movement type group you are trying to maintain is set up as a revaluated movement type group. In SAP, revaluated movement types are used for specific purposes, such as inventory revaluation, and manual changes to these groups are restricted to maintain data integrity and consistency.

    Solution:

    To resolve the OM525 error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check Movement Type Configuration:

      • Go to the transaction code OMJJ (or SPRO -> Logistics Execution -> Inventory Management -> Movement Types -> Define Movement Types).
      • Review the movement type group settings to confirm if the movement type you are trying to maintain is indeed marked as revaluated.
    2. Avoid Manual Changes:

      • If the movement type is revaluated, you should avoid trying to manually change the movement type group. Instead, use the appropriate configuration settings or processes that are designed for revaluated movement types.
